Location: Near Reading (remote with adhoc site visits)

Duration: 6 month contract

IR35: Inside IR35

Role details:

Our client, a key player in the Defence & Security sector, is seeking two Courseware Designers/Analysts to join their remote team with ad hoc travel to locations near Reading. This is a 6-month contract position.

Key Responsibilities:

Work as part of a team responsible for the analysis, design, maintenance, review, and production of DSAT Documentation & processes for military training sites and organisations.Analyse, capture, and articulate training needs arising from new or changing requirements.Inform on optimum training solutions to meet training requirements, balancing time, cost, and quality.Produce, maintain, and update Training Design from various formal training documents to delivery of assessment strategies and specifications.Interview subject matter experts to collate required data.Participate in internal workshops to discuss and agree on findings from analysis.Upkeep, update, and revalidation of course syllabi, standards, and trainer competence requirements.Maintain Training Design in response to new training requirements, ensuring it satisfies operational/workplace performance requirements.

Job Requirements:

Experience in defence training course design and analysis roles.Excellent communication skills required at all levels both internally and within the customer organisation.Ability to work autonomously and within a team environment.Understanding of training design and development processes for training media.

Desirable Skills:

Experience in organisational design and development.Experience in the development of apprenticeship qualifications.Degree-level education in a relevant area.Teaching and training development qualifications at degree level.Human Resource Development qualification and experience.Membership in an appropriate professional body such as CIPD.
